When are you biased?
I am biased when I have a personal preference or inclination that affects my judgment or decision-making. Bias can also occur when I have limited information or experience with a particular topic, leading me to rely on preconceived notions or stereotypes. It's important for me to recognize and acknowledge my biases in order to strive for fair and objective responses.

Is what the therapist says not biased?
Therapists are trained to be as objective and unbiased as possible in their interactions with clients. They are trained to listen without judgment and to provide support and guidance without imposing their own personal biases. However, therapists are also human and may have their own biases, so it's important for clients to feel comfortable addressing any concerns about potential bias in therapy. Additionally, seeking out a therapist who is culturally competent and aware of their own biases can help ensure a more balanced and effective therapeutic relationship.

Why are many Germans biased against Turks?
Many Germans are biased against Turks due to a combination of historical, cultural, and economic factors. The history of Turkish immigration to Germany, starting in the 1960s, has led to tensions and prejudices. Additionally, cultural differences and misunderstandings can contribute to bias. Economic competition and perceived threats to job opportunities can also fuel negative attitudes towards Turkish immigrants. These factors, along with the lack of integration and acceptance, have contributed to the bias against Turks in Germany.

How can one deal with biased teachers?
Dealing with biased teachers can be challenging, but it's important to approach the situation with professionalism and open-mindedness. One approach is to try to have an open and honest conversation with the teacher to express your concerns and provide specific examples of bias. It can also be helpful to seek support from other students, parents, or school administrators to address the issue. Additionally, focusing on your own learning and seeking out diverse perspectives from other sources can help mitigate the impact of biased teaching.
